Marketing alternatives for Alaska North Slope natural gas. Hearing before the Subcommittee on Energy Regulation of the Committee on Energy and Natural Resources, United States Senate, Ninety-Eighth Congress, First Session, November 16, 1983

Local businesses and representatives of the natural gas industry were among the witnesses at a hearing held to explore marketing alternatives for Alaska's natural gas reserves, which amount to a proven 26 trillion cubic feet in the Prudhoe Bay area and an estimated 109 trillion cubic feet of recoverable gas to be discovered in the Arctic area. The formation of new pipeline companies, competition with Canada for Pacific Rim markets, and the role of government on the financing of natural gas development and distribution were the major points of discussion. Three appendices with responses and additional material submitted for the record follow the testimony of 18 witnesses.
